Classroom-Friendly Spectral Sensor now Available

Apr 02 2015

Ocean Optics' new Spark spectral sensor uses optical technology advances to shrink instrument size, making it the smallest on the market to date. The Spark-VIS is the first offering in the Spark line of versatile spectral sensors, delivering high resolution measurements over the visible wavelength range of 380-700 nm. The compact Spark-VIS is ideal for simple absorbance, fluorescence and emissive colour measurements. With an easy-to-use design, it is a great introduction to the world of spectroscopy. Its low cost allows hands on use by every student in the classroom.

The stand-alone Spark-VIS is easy to use, with plug and play USB connectivity. Its low cost makes it a good option for budget-conscious student labs in schools and universities. A line of Spark accessories, including clip-on cuvette holders, diffusers, and light sources make a variety of experimental setups possible. Rather than watching a demo or reading theory from book, Spark-VIS makes possible first-hand learning about rates of reactions, Beer’s Law, atomic emission lines, chemical composition and more. Students can capture data in real time with spectral acquisition and analysis from Ocean Optics’ OceanView software.
